Selecting Stone Surfaces: Everything You Need to Know

Understanding the installation process can help you get ready for your new kitchen counters. The process involves several stages:

  1. Template Creation: A pattern of your area is created to ensure a accurate fit.
  2. Cutting: The granite slab is trimmed to align with the template.
  3. Edge Profiling: Sides are shaped according to your selection, whether beveled or sharp.
  4. Polishing: The top is finished to enhance its natural beauty.
  5. Installation: The surface is installed and secured in location.
  6. Sealing: A sealant is used to safeguard the stone from spills.

Care Guidelines for Stone Surfaces

To keep your kitchen counters looking like new, follow these care guidelines:

  • Regular Cleaning: Use a non-abrasive soap and microfiber cloth to clean the stone regularly.
  •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Avoid using harsh chemicals that can deteriorate the surface.
  • Seal Periodically: Apply a sealer annually to keep defense against spills.
  • Use Cutting Boards: Avoid scratches by employing cutting boards for cutting.
  • Wipe Up Spills Immediately: Clean up spills as soon as they occur to stop staining.
